I found a banshee that looks real nice, the kid says that it needs the swingarm bearings replaced, he has the parts. How hard is it to do? I work on my car quite a bit, but I have never touched a quad. Any help would be great.
all you have to do is get the bolt out, punch the old bearings out, and press the new bearings and spacer in. The only hard part should be breaking loose the bolt and getting the bolt out. there are a crapload of other topics about this so maybe some of them will help you :tup:
